General Info
In Block
e152c6469fb99f0f7b9619491e792518071c6e3dd2ae43666100900fe7f98f83
In block height
Total Input
2248573.69230242 RDD
Total Output
2249333.3179249 RDD
Transaction Details
Fee
0 RDD
mined Thu, 17 Jun 2021 21:44:44 UTC
From
2248573.69230242 RDD